How long does it take to receive a TWIC after applying?
Asked 2 years ago
After submitting an application for a Transportation Worker Identification Credential, the processing time can vary. Generally, applicants may expect to receive their TWIC within approximately 2 to 6 weeks from the date of their application, assuming there are no complications or additional security checks needed. Several factors can influence this timeframe, including the volume of applications being processed and the specific background check requirements for each applicant. It is important for individuals to ensure that their application is completed accurately and all required documentation is provided, as this can help expedite the review process. For the most current information regarding processing times or any changes to the application process, reviewing the official TWIC website may be beneficial.
